About Bachelor of Computer Applications [BCA]

The Bachelor of Computer Applications [BCA] at Ashoka Institute of Technology and Management [AITM], Varanasi is a 3-year full-time undergraduate program affiliated to Dr. A.P.J. Abdul Kalam Technical University [AKTU], Lucknow. The program covers core computer science subjects including programming languages (C, C++, Java, Python), database management, web development, software engineering, networking, and data structures, preparing students for careers in IT, software development, and related fields. The total 3-year fee is approximately Rs. 2,31,500, with a first-year fee of Rs. 92,500. BCA is a popular choice for students seeking a career in IT without pursuing B.Tech, and it also serves as a pathway to MCA for higher studies.

AITM BCA Fees

The total fee for the BCA program at AITM Varanasi over 3 years is approximately Rs. 2,31,500. The first-year fee is Rs. 92,500, which includes registration, tuition, development charges, training & placement fee, and refundable caution money. Subsequent years are lower as one-time charges are not repeated. University examination fees are paid directly to AKTU by students.

Fee Breakdown

Fee ComponentYear IYear IIYear IIITotal
Registration FeeRs. 3,000--Rs. 3,000
Tuition FeeRs. 51,500Rs. 51,500Rs. 51,500Rs. 1,54,500
Admission Fee / Development / Campus Activity / Insurance / Lab / Sports / ERP / Internet / Internal Exam / Alumni FeeRs. 24,000Rs. 9,000Rs. 9,000Rs. 42,000
Training & Placement / Soft Skills FeeRs. 9,000Rs. 9,000Rs. 9,000Rs. 27,000
Caution Money (Refundable)Rs. 5,000--Rs. 5,000
Total FeesRs. 92,500Rs. 69,500Rs. 69,500Rs. 2,31,500
  • Caution Money of Rs. 5,000 is refundable at the time of leaving the institution.
  • Admission Fee and Alumni Fee are one-time charges applicable only at the time of admission (Year I).
  • AKTU University Examination Fee is paid directly by students to AKTU and is not included above.
  • All fees are subject to revision by the Fee Fixation Committee, Uttar Pradesh.
  • Hostel facility is available on campus; hostel fees are charged separately.

AITM BCA Admission 2026

Admission to BCA at AITM Varanasi is primarily through UPTAC counselling. Candidates must have passed 10+2 with Mathematics as a compulsory subject. For 2026-27, UPTAC BCA counselling is expected to begin tentatively in May-June 2026. Management quota seats are available through direct application to the college.

Eligibility Criteria:

  • Candidates must have passed 10+2 (or equivalent) with Mathematics as a compulsory subject from a recognized board.
  • Minimum 45% aggregate marks in the qualifying examination (40% for SC/ST candidates).
  • No specific entrance exam is mandatory; admission is merit-based on 10+2 marks through UPTAC counselling.

Admission Process:

  • Register on the UPTAC portal (uptac.admissions.nic.in) for BCA counselling
  • Upload required documents and pay registration fee
  • Fill and lock choices during the choice filling window
  • Receive seat allotment and pay seat confirmation fee
  • Report physically to AITM Varanasi with original documents
  • Alternatively, apply directly to AITM for management quota seats via the college website (ashokainstitute.com)

AITM BCA Scholarships 2026

Students enrolled in BCA at AITM Varanasi can avail various scholarships from state and central government bodies. The UP State Post-Matric Scholarship is particularly beneficial for students from reserved categories, covering a significant portion of tuition fees.

Available Scholarships

ScholarshipEligibilityAmount / Benefit
UP State Government Scholarship (Post-Matric)SC/ST/OBC/General-EWS students domiciled in UPFull or partial tuition fee reimbursement as per UP government norms
AICTE Pragati ScholarshipFemale students in technical educationRs. 50,000 per year (tuition fee + incidentals)
AICTE Saksham ScholarshipDifferently-abled students in technical educationRs. 50,000 per year (tuition fee + incidentals)
Merit-based Fee Concession (AITM)Top-ranking students in 10+2 Board examsPartial fee waiver as per college policy
  • UP State Scholarship applications are submitted online via the UP Scholarship portal (scholarship.up.gov.in); deadline is usually October-November each year.
  • AICTE scholarships are applied through the AICTE portal; deadlines are announced annually.
  • Students must maintain minimum attendance and academic performance to retain scholarships.

Q2. Is BCA better than B.Tech CSE at AITM Varanasi?

A2. BCA and B.Tech CSE both focus on computer science, but B.Tech CSE is a 4-year engineering degree with a broader technical curriculum and generally better placement prospects in core IT companies. BCA is a 3-year program that is more affordable (Rs. 2,31,500 vs Rs. 4,17,262 for B.Tech CSE) and quicker to complete. BCA is a good option for students who want to enter the IT field quickly or pursue MCA, while B.Tech CSE is preferred for engineering roles and higher-paying IT jobs.

Q3. Can I pursue MCA after BCA from AITM Varanasi?

A3. Yes, BCA graduates are eligible to pursue MCA [Master of Computer Applications] after completing their degree. They can appear for NIMCET, CUET PG, or other MCA entrance exams. MCA after BCA provides a strong foundation for senior IT roles and is equivalent to an M.Tech in terms of career prospects in the IT sector.

Q6. Is Mathematics compulsory for BCA admission at AITM Varanasi?

A6. Yes, as per AKTU norms, Mathematics is a compulsory subject in 10+2 for BCA admission. Students who have studied Commerce with Mathematics or Science with Mathematics are eligible. Students from Arts stream without Mathematics may not be eligible for BCA admission through UPTAC counselling.
